IEDPU condemns recent looting in Ilorin as victims say incident contradicts Ilorin culture

Date: 2020-10-26

The Ilorin Emirate Descendants Progressive Union (IEDPU) has condemned,in its strongest term, the mindless looting and destruction of some government facilities and business establishments across the city of Ilorin over the weekend by those it called unscrupulous people hiding under the guise of protest against police brutality.

The Union said that it was very clear that the criminality was perpetuated by hardened criminals and not the peaceful protesters who had conducted themselves with civility and decorum before the process was unfortunately hijacked as the victims of the incident also joined the Union in expressing doubt that any indigene of Ilorin could either partake or encourage such criminality.

A statement signed by the National Publicity Secretary of the Union, Abubakar Imam, quoted the National President of the Union, Alhaji Aliyu Otta Uthman, fsi,as stating the position on Monday(October 26,2020) when he led a delegation of the National Executive Council of the Union on sympathy visit to victims of the unfortunate incident at their various places of business.

Alhaji Uthman,who led the delegation to the popular Shoprite on Fate Road as well as Fonemart and Femtech on Taiwo Road, among other places,said that the development was not only "a distasteful episode in the history of Ilorin but an instance that was completely at variance with the character and characteristics of the good people of Ilorin Emirate who are generally known as law-abiding and peace loving".

The community leader said that the incident came to the Union as an "indescribable surprise",adding that it was not only "despicable and unreasonable but also absolutely unacceptable".He added that all hands must be on deck towards ensuring that such a dastardly act is not allowed to rear its ugly head again.

Alhaji Uthman,while saying that the Union was perfecting a mechanism through which greater support would be granted the constituted authorities towards ensuring that its geographical jurisdiction is more secured,commiserated with the victims of the incidents.

The retired Director of the Department of State Services said that the community would not condoned any form of criminality, adding that the weekend incident was "uncalled for and a terrible tendency",which must be condemned in its entirety.

He added that the Union decided to pay the visit to enable it adequately assess the level of damages and interact with those who are directly affected and sympathise with them on behalf of the entire people of Ilorin Emirate who are still in shock that such a terrible act could happened on their soil.

The IEDPU President also sympathised with the Executive Governor of Kwara State, Mallam AbdulRahman AbdulRasaq, on the unfortunate development. Alhaji Uthman appreciated the Governor for the decision of his government to support the victims through the sum of N500,000,000:00 it has set aside and other measures ,which,he said, would go a long way in augmenting other efforts being made here and there to bring back their businesses into shape.

The IEDPU President also commiserated with the Emir of Ilorin, Alhaji(Dr)Ibrahim Sulu-Gambari, CFR,over the unfortunate incident, praying that may the Ilorin Emirate and Kwara State never witness such a development again.

Responding,the Operation Manager of Shoprite,Mr Banji Aiyenitaju, who stood in for the Ilorin Shoprite Center Manager,Mr.Shakiru Gbadamosi, expressed the appreciations of the management and staff of the outfit to the IEDPU leadership for deeming it fit to pay them a sympathy visit. At Fonemart, the Auditor of the firm,Mrs Funmi Oguniyi ,who received the IEDPU delegation on behalf of the Chief Executive of the business enterprise,said that she and her colleagues were quite sure that the attacks were planned and executed by outsiders, saying that Ilorin was too peaceful, as a community, for such a terrible incident to be perpetrated by its indigenes.
